ARINC807-4
This document is based upon the SAE ARP5602 document, A Guideline for Aerospace Platform Fiber Optic Training and Awareness Education. ARINC Report 807: Fiber Optic Training Requirements is a subset of the SAE ARP5602 document designed to meet the requirements of the commercial air transport industry. Certification to the SAE ARP5602 document fulfills the requirements of ARINC Report 807. This document defines recommended general practices for training requirements of aerospace fiber optic systems. It is the intention of this document to outline proven training practices and general standards of workmanship for technicians engaged in aerospace fiber optic manufacturing, installation, maintenance, and repair for the air transport industry. It is also recommended that management and purchasing personnel receive fundamental training to familiarize themselves with the requirements of aerospace fiber optics.

ARINC803-4
The purpose of ARINC Report 803 is to provide design and implementation guidelines together with a selection guide, providing a fiber optic system design engineer with documentation to assess the design requirements for an aerospace fiber optic installation.

ARINC610A-1
This standard preserves all of the technical concepts of ARINC 610. ARINC 610A encompasses the lessons learned since ARINC 610 was issued, provides additional information defining each simulator function and the responses required by each type, and creates guidance information relevant to Integrated Modular Avionics (IMA).

ARINC610-1
This standard sets forth general philosophy and design guidance for using aircraft avionics equipment in simulators. Its goal is to improve simulator training by providing a better understanding among avionics designers, simulator designers, airframe manufacturers and airline simulator users in the use of aircraft avionic equipment in flight simulators. Full flight simulator, cockpit procedure trainer, cockpit system simulator or fixed base simulator, part task trainer (e.g., flight management system trainer), and maintenance training simulator guidance is included.

ARINC607-3
This standard provides general guidelines for the design of avionics equipment. It represents the desires of the airline industry resulting from extensive airline experience. Manufacturers are urged to use this standard when initially starting the design of new equipment. Airplane Personality Module (APM) specifications are included.
